YouTube: Brand overview

YouTube is a multilingual video hosting from the USA. It appeared in 2005, initiated by former employees of the PayPal payment system Jawed Karim, Steve Shih Chen, and Chad Meredith Hurley. Since November 2006, it has been owned by internet giant Google.

2011–2013

The original design was preserved, but changes were made to the color scheme. For example, the rectangle became burgundy, and a gray haze appeared at the bottom of the word “Tube,” reaching the middle of the letters.

2013–2015

In 2013, the emblem’s design was changed: the rectangular icon on the right became crimson with a slight gradient at the bottom. The inscription “You” on the left became black.

2015–2017

After another revision of the logo, the palette was changed again. In this version, the shading at the bottom of the rectangle was removed, and it acquired a pure red color without tonal transitions.

2017 — today

In 2017, the company’s management conducted a redesign of the logo, radically changing its image. The phrase “YouTube” is written together in the current version, highlighting the capital letters.

Before, it was a red rectangular button with a white triangle in the center — this was the designation for launching a video for viewing. The style of the inscription remained the same: the only change was the deepening of the letter “Y,” which became more elongated.

In 2012, entrepreneurs decided that the CRT on the logo does not convey the essence of the world’s largest video hosting service. Moreover, they wanted to introduce new features and applications into their web service that would not be associated with the last century’s technologies.

It was an evolution that affected all areas of YouTube’s activity.

Christopher Bettig, the art director, speculated that people might not even realize the meaning of the word “Tube” and do not understand why it is in a rectangle.

Therefore, it was decided to remove the red TV screen and shift the focus from “Tube” to the video playback icon. Thus, the most significant redesign in the company’s history took place.

FAQ

What does the YouTube logo symbolize?

The red rectangle with a white triangle in the center represents the video play button. This element symbolizes the main task that YouTube copes with well — providing users with the ability to upload, search, and view video content.

What was the original YouTube logo?

The original logo contained the two-tone word “YouTube.” The first half of the name was black with a white background, and the second half was white and written inside a red rectangle with rounded corners and a gradient.
